Mybatis
Romanceling
LANG
展开
-
Mybatis - #{}及${}传值的区别
别人的总结:点击打开链接 简单总结下: 1.#{}会将传入的值转译成字符串,安全。 2.${}不会修改或转译传入的值,可能会产生sql注入攻击。通常是需要传入数据库对象的情况下使用,比如传入表名,字段名(order by后使用较多)。转载 2016-10-11 16:06:57 · 428 阅读 · 0 评论 -
Mybatis一对一和一对多
大神总结的真好:点击打开链接 简单总结: 1.association:一对一,“有一个”的关系。 如一个班级有一个老师: property:对象属性的名称javaType:对象属性的类型column:所对应的外键字段名称select:使用另一个查询封装的结果 public class Teacher { //定义实体类的属性,与teacher表中的字段对应转载 2016-10-12 09:38:53 · 515 阅读 · 0 评论